About Oslo (OSL)

The economic, political and demographic centre, Oslo, is the capital and the largest city if Norway. The city has a special combination of city life and easy access to great outdoors. The city is the largest capitals in the world in terms of area, most of which covered by forests making the city in close contact with the nature surrounding it and also gives the hints of wild wonders that lie just beyond the city. It is the country's premier business centre and has a diverse and dynamic economy. The city is well served with three airports, Oslo Airport, one of the largest airport, Sandefjord Airport and Moss Airport along with public transport such as train services, bus services, boat services, taxi and car services. Oslo is also a home to some of the diverse and amazing museums, parks and structures. Frogner Park is one of the biggest and most reputed park with a large collection of sculptures of Gustav Vigeland. Bygdoy is a huge green area also called as the Museum Peninsula of Oslo is a beautiful location surrounded by sea. Opera House is Norway's first entry in the top league of modern architecture. The Norwegian Museum of Cultural History is an open air museum featuring buildings from various periods of Norwegian history. Aker Brygge is a major seaside shopping and nightlife centre with lots of glam and fun. Akersgata is a brand new high-end shopping centre with one of the few exclusive brands from all over the world. Bogstadvelen is a shopping street giving you a huge collection of non brand clothes and accessories. The city has a lot of both expensive and cheap restaurants available serving worldwide cuisines. The city is also a place giving you a huge option for pubs, bars and nightclubs. The city also serves one of the best coffees in the world and you will find one of the best cafe's around the city. About Milan (MIL)

Famously known for its historic richness and modernised sights, Milan, stands firm as the financial hub of Italy. The city has fetched the second most populous city tag and still manages to be the urban area of the country. Milan has re-formed itself after the destructive war, and now it appears no less than a striking cosmopolitan location. What makes Milan an interesting location for the tourists is the zest to live life with all its diverse colours and shades. The city enjoys every moment from shopping, playing, singing, theatres, to the exuberant night-life. It is considered as the fashion capital of Italy, fashionistas, media and socialites from all over the world gather at the place to capture the true essence of fashion. Some of the scenic locations of the city includes, 'The Duomo', which is by far the biggest Gothic Cathedrals in the whole world, 'The Brera art gallery', 'La Scala, one of the famous opera houses, 'The Pirelli Tower', a great example of the modern Italian architecture, 'The Castello Sforzesco', and 'The San Siro'. The cherry on the cake is the famous painting โ€œLeonardo Da Vinciโ€, which has time and again earned laurels for the city. The tourists can comfortably plan a trip to Milan at any time of the year, as the city observes a considerate weather throughout the year. The best way to get in to the city is to travel by air. One can land at the Malpensa Airport, Orlo Al Serio Airport, or Linate Airport, or can opt for the other mediums, like trains, buses and cars, depending on their suitability and comfort. With numerous scenic museums, palaces, building, monuments, and streets, Milan forms itself into an exquisite bouquet of beautiful surroundings. The culture of serving 'Aperitivo' is well established in Milan. In this meal, many bars offers drinks and cocktails at a fixed price, and the drinks are well complemented with snacks and small appetizers. There are other restaurants as well who serve delectable cuisines to the visitors. The night-life of the city is happening and vibrant with places to go and mingle with your dear ones.
